Simon Gault is one of New Zealand's best-known chefs. Trained locally, with extensive overseas experience, Simon has built a loyal following through his innovative and thoroughly stylish menus. Euro, Pasha, Pravda, Shed 5 and The Jervois Steakhouse are just some of the renowned restaurants co-owned by Simon Gault which also feature Gault designed menus. Nourish contains a fabulous selection of recipes from these establishments, ranging from tapas and seafood through to hearty steak dishes and dynamic desserts. There's also a section of Simon's own favourites. The outstanding food photography and restaurant images are by leading photographer Kieran Scott. Internationally respected Master Chef Simon Gault has a remarkable talent for bringing together tastes and techniques from around the world.
His global experience allows him to savour in his mind the blending of Oriental with European and produce some of the best and most innovative dishes presented in New Zealand. His many awards and international recognition attest to his superb skill.
Simons outgoing personality, passion and commitment to absolute food perfection makes him a culinary dream with a vision to constantly push the boundaries of ingredients, taste, depth and flavour.
A traveling and working portfolio in the world's finest kitchens has enabled Simon to open a string of restaurants that all enjoy enviable critical recognition in Auckland, Taupo and Wellington.
Throughout all of this Simon continues to travel extensively so as to gain greater appreciation of world culinary trends. His leisure time passion is flying and he is a glider pilot instructor and pilot of vintage military aircraft as a member of Warbirds.
